KuCoin to Pay $300M in Fines: A Turning Point for Crypto Regulation

Cryptocurrency has grown dramatically over the past decade, but with growth comes increased scrutiny from regulatory bodies worldwide. One major cryptocurrency exchange recently found itself in the crosshairs of regulators. The company has pleaded guilty to running the business without the necessary licenses and agreed to pay a total of $300 million in penalties – including $113 million in fines and $184.5 million in forfeitures. History of Regulatory Issues

KuCoin’s run-ins with the authorities are not something new. Earlier in 2023, it settled with the New York authorities and agreed to pay $22 million and stop its operations within the state. It marked an increasing trend of concern towards KuCoin’s practices regarding compliance and its preparedness to comply with the legal requirements of the jurisdictions to which it catered.

Although KuCoin’s innovative offerings and user-friendly platform have attracted a significant following among crypto enthusiasts, its operations have been an open concern for the regulators. The primary reason for this is the fact that the platform failed to secure the required licenses to operate in specific regions, an infraction that has finally caught up with the company in the form of the $300 million fine imposed recently.


The Penalty Components

There are two significant parts of the settlement:

Fines: KuCoin is to pay a fine of $113 million due to a failure in producing a license to operate in the crypto market. The amount is severe and will be a warning to other crypto firms dealing in such ambiguous procedures.

The balance of $184.5 million will remain forfeited as part of the settlement. The idea is very likely to be restoration of the losses incurred to affected users or revenue generated from unlicensed operations.

The sheer scale of this penalty underscores the importance of regulatory compliance in the crypto industry. It also sets a precedent for how authorities may handle similar cases in the future.


Implications for the Crypto Industry

The KuCoin case demonstrates how regulatory pressure on crypto exchanges is increasing day by day. These governments are focused on ensuring the transparency of crypto platforms and protecting users from fraudulent activities, money laundering, and market manipulation.

For crypto companies, the message is clear: compliance is no longer optional. Failure to adhere to regulations can result in severe financial and reputational damage. The case of KuCoin’s penalty also comes as a reminder that regulators will not hesitate in taking decisive steps to hold the non-compliant entities accountable.
